William Everson

Birth10 Jul 1777 - Halvergate, Norfolk, England
Death21 May 1866 - Halvergate, Norfolk, England
MotherJudith Beverley
FatherWilliam Everson

Born in Halvergate, Norfolk, England on 10 Jul 1777 to William Everson and Judith Beverley. William Everson married Mary Williams and had 9 children. He passed away on 21 May 1866 in Halvergate, Norfolk, England.
